Transaction 31535a6203190fa75d2ed693333291e40a8d7747acfd9abbfb29e42236c5ce78

2 Input
2 Outputs
  • 31535a6203190fa75d2ed693333291e40a8d7747acfd9abbfb29e42236c5ce78:0
  • value  780900
    address  13chM52KD2BqhHxJR7bnaaCyhhqX71sqdw
  • 31535a6203190fa75d2ed693333291e40a8d7747acfd9abbfb29e42236c5ce78:1
  • value  37488
    address  1Ba97v7D52D7ihZ56RqXApryVNzahRkJ4